Caution
CAUTION indicates a potentially hazardous situation which, if not
avoided, may result in a minor or moderate injury.
å
Leaking, overheating, or damaged battery could result in fi re or injury.
- Use battery with the correct specifi cation for the camera.
- Do not short circuit, heat or dispose of battery in fi re.
- Do not insert the battery with the polarities reversed.
å
Remove the battery when not planning to use the camera for a
long period of time. Otherwise the battery may leak corrosive
electrolyte and permanently damage the camera’s components.
å
Do not fi re the fl ash while it is in contact with hands or objects. Do
not touch the fl ash after using it continuously. It may cause burns.
å
Make sure that any connector cords or cables to other devices
are disconnected before moving the camera. Failure to do so may
damage the cords or cables and cause a fi re or electric shock.
å
Take care not to touch the lens or lens cover to avoid taking an
unclear image and possibly causing camera malfunction.
å
Avoid obstructing the lens or the fl ash when you capture an image.
å
Credit cards may be demagnetized if left near case. Avoid leaving
magnetic strip cards near the case.
å
Never connect the 20 pin connector to the USB port of a PC. This
carries a high risk of computer malfunction.
å
After turning on the camera, Check whether the battery type and
the camera setting set on the [Settings] > [Battery Type] menu
(p. 52) are same.
